There was a time when Apple was shipping dual-processor G4s, but Mac OS 9, in general, could only use one processor. There was a system extension that allowed Photoshop to use both. A co-worker of mine had one, and it was very much a system used for running Photoshop. At that time OS X was considered too slow for professional work. So bundling made a lot of sense.
